Abstract

The utility model provides a kind of external patchcord protective device of Temporary cardiac pacing, comprising: shell, inside are in hollow form structure setting; installation space as external adapter; wherein, the both ends of shell respectively offer multiple through slots, match with the quantity of the binding post on external adapter.The external patchcord protective device of a kind of Temporary cardiac pacing provided by the utility model; external adapter is built in shell; and pass through the binding post on adapter outside the through slot relative positioning fixed body on shell; it is set to be not easy in shell opposite shake; even if to guarantee sufferer in rotation or moving process; the junction of binding post does not loosen on its external adapter, guarantees the reliability of Data Detection, prevents the generation of medical-risk.

Background technique
Temporary cardiac pacing is mainly used for bradycardia and/or the of short duration disease for stopping Acute Hemodynamic caused by fighting People, wherein pacemaker when in use, is used cooperatively with external external adapter, medical staff is enabled to pass through instrument Device understands the heart condition of sufferer in real time, and still, existing external adapter is only merely to hang or be simply secured to sufferer Body on, when sufferer turn round or moving process in, may result in external adapter and also shift, so that body The junction of binding post loosens on outer adapter, and then leads to the inaccuracy of Data Detection, and there are certain medical wind Danger.

As depicted in figs. 1 and 2, the external patchcord protective device of a kind of Temporary cardiac pacing provided by the utility model, It include: shell 100, inside is in hollow form structure setting, the installation space as external adapter 200, wherein shell 100 Both ends respectively offer multiple through slots 111, match with the quantity of the binding post 210 on external adapter 200, when external adapter 200 when being placed in 100 inside of shell, and the binding post 210 at both ends is respectively accordingly in through slot 111, thus fixed body The relative position of outer adapter 200 in a housing 100.
In the present embodiment, the quantity of the binding post 210 at external 200 both ends of adapter is respectively two and one, therefore, The both ends of shell 100 open up accordingly respectively there are two and a through slot 111, realize binding post 210 and 111 quantity of through slot with And the one-to-one relationship of position.
The external patchcord protective device of a kind of Temporary cardiac pacing provided by the utility model, by external adapter 200 It is built in shell 100, and passes through the binding post on the outer adapter 200 of 111 relative positioning fixed body of through slot on shell 100 210, so that it is not easy in shell 100 opposite shaking, even if to guarantee that sufferer in rotation or moving process, turns in vitro The junction for connecing binding post 210 on device 200 does not loosen, and then improves the reliability of Data Detection, prevents medical-risk Occur.
Preferably, as depicted in figs. 1 and 2, shell 100 includes bottom cover 110, covers 120 and be separately connected bottom and cover 110 and The hinge 130 of capping 120 realizes the folding of shell 100, wherein through slot 111 is opened in bottom cover 110, and when needing, loading is external to be turned When connecing device 200, capping 120 (so that capping 120 is rotated around hinge 130) is opened, external adapter 200 is then put into bottom cover In 110, at this point, the corresponding through slot 111 on bottom cover 110 respectively by the binding post 210 at external 200 both ends of adapter It is interior, to limit external adapter 200 in the freedom degree of shell 100 or so and upper and lower two sides, capping 120 is finally covered, in turn Freedom degree of the outer adapter 200 of lock body in 100 front and rear sides of shell.
It is further preferred that as depicted in figs. 1 and 2, a buckle 121 is provided at the edge of capping 120, when bottom is covered 110 with capping 120 close when, pass through buckle 121 realize capping 120 and bottom cover 110 between locking.
It is further preferred that as depicted in figs. 1 and 2, wherein one end of through slot 111 is arranged in convex structure, general body The section of the binding post 210 of outer sensor is rounded, when external sensor is placed in shell 100, the circular arc of binding post 210 Lateral wall of the structure just with binding post 210 matches.
Preferably, as depicted in figs. 1 and 2, circular hole 112 there are two being opened up in the wherein one side wall of bottom cover 110, as soft Channel is penetrated in wearing for rope, when using protective device, by wearing the tightrope penetrated in circular hole 112, is hung on the chest of sufferer Before, the frequency of its shaking is reduced, the accuracy of patient data detection is further increased.
Preferably, as depicted in figs. 1 and 2, at least provided with one group of slotted hole 113 on bottom cover 110, and every group of slotted hole 113 quantity is two, penetrates channel as wearing for tightrope, and wears and penetrate tightrope here protective device is bundled in sufferer Limbs on, thus reduce its shaking frequency, further increase patient data detection accuracy.It is further preferred that long The quantity of circular hole 113 is two groups, in being symmetrical arranged up and down, is bundled by the bilateral of upper and lower ends, further increases patient data The accuracy of detection.
Preferably, as depicted in figs. 1 and 2, it is also respectively connected with a flexible cushion block 114 at the both ends of bottom cover 110, it is general to protect The material of protection unit need to use transparent plastic material, and surface has certain hardness, when protective device is bundled in the limb of sufferer When on body, hard collision can make sufferer when wearing the protective device, feel uncomfortable, and by flexible cushion block 114, make It obtains the contact between protective device and sufferer limbs and is changed to flexible contact, improve the comfort that sufferer uses.
